Northrop Grumman has an opening for a Structural Engineer with a Dynamics emphasis. This position will be located in Clearfield, UT.

We perform cradle-to-grave analysis, design, and manufacturing for state of the art commercial and military programs. Our team works with cutting edge exotic materials and novel products to innovate within our mission, working across the facility supporting large composite structures. Essential Functions:

  • Perform static and dynamic analysis of composite and metallic parts and assemblies.

  • Able to manipulate large scale finite element models that support internal loads development.

  • Conduct modal and random vibration analysis for product design and to establish fatigue life.

Northrop Grumman leads the industry team for NASA’s James Webb Space Telescope, the largest, most complex and powerful space telescope ever built. Launched in December 2021, the telescope incorporates innovative design, advanced technology, and groundbreaking engineering, and will fundamentally alter our understanding of the universe.
